2016 Q5 4NR Day 22 : Dannok – Kuala Lumpur

“There are better starters than me but I’m a strong finisher…” - Usain Bolt

(Crossing the border to home sweet home)

Day 22: Sunday, 18 Dec 2016
Route: Dannok – Kuala Lumpur
Distance: 499 km


They were many tourists staying in Oliver Hotel so the process of checking out this morning was a little slow. To beat the morning crowd, by 8:45 am we were ready to ride to the Bukit Kayu Hitam border. Border clearance was swift and by 9:00 am we entered our mother land safely.

Once in Changlun, we refuelled then detoured to Kg. Chermai, Perlis for a hearty delicious early lunch prepared by Mak Chun, Mad Wan’s beloved dotting mother. This is a repeat of last year after we completed our 4th four-nation ride with the KKB gang.

The weather was sunny and clear when we rode back towards KL and reached our Bidara House around 4:00 pm.

Alhamdulillah…
